#cca380 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cca380 is composed of 80% red, 63.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.1%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 27.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.7% and a lightness of 65.1%. #cca380 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#994701.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#cca380 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#cca380 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cca380 has RGB values of R:204, G:163,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.37,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13411200.

Shades and Tints of #cca380
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0905 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cca380
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a6a2 is the less saturated color, while #fc9f50 is the most saturated one.
